So I used to have Ubuntu installed on my computer on a second HDD, now I decided to format that drive and install Win7 over it. However, I still get the Grub 1.5 bootloader which gives me "error 17" on startup and I cannot fix that in any way so far. I have XP on my "good" HDD because I was just going to try Win7, but I can't access that without the XP CD or a functional bootloader.
So far I tried bootrec /fixmbr, bootrec /fixboot and bootrec /rebuildbcd. I can still access Win7 if I use the DVD when I start up my computer.
